So what are the common and the typical symptoms that you need to be aware of? In many cases, the most important sign of this symptom is that difficulty of lifting the front part of your foot. If you experience this one right now, then better check out with your doctor. Another sign that you should know is that your foot may drag on the floor the moment you walk or you may slap down on the floor for every step that you take.
There is one simple solution that you can take if you experience this kind of condition. You can compensate for this difficulty by raising your thigh high every time you walk or you can raise your thigh if you are to climb the stairs. What you are doing is called the ‘steppage gait’. This kind of signs can be coupled with the pain, the weakness and the numbness on your foot drop. You need to remember that this kind of condition will only affect your one foot, and depending on the actual cause of the situation you may experience this on both feet.
But do remember that this kind of condition is not a disease; rather this one is just a symptom of a more serious issue. For example, this can be brought by a neurological disorder of even an anatomical issue. You should also know that this can be temporary or this can be permanent and this will depend on the actual cause of the condition.
